About this property
Elegantly renovated just footsteps from Eglinton Reserve, this double fronted Victorian's period charm, spacious single level proportions and sunny garden parcel form the perfect combination for easy contemporary living. Positioned on 385sqm (approx.) with a remote double garage, its three bedroom, two bathroom accommodation with multiple living areas, brilliant indoor/outdoor entertaining and landscaped easy care garden is as ideal for families as those seeking to downsize without compromise. All the romance of the era remains in an enchanting verandah façade that offers an irresistible introduction to a traditional arched hallway, around which five original rooms retain their high ceilings and rich classical refinement. Here, two formal living rooms feature handsome open fireplaces while three bedrooms include the main with a walk-in robe and timeless contemporary ensuite, and two with built-in robes served by a smart family bathroom featuring a clawfoot bath and separate powder room. Beyond, a soaring skylight illuminates a stone finished kitchen equipped with smeg appliances, extensive storage and a central island, overlooking generous family living/dining areas that, with bifold doors, step out to the impressive alfresco "room" featuring dual ceiling fans, downlights, BBQ rangehood and a wall mounted TV. Feature paving connects these areas to the delightful adjoining garden where extensive paving, manicured lawned areas and a range of carefully considered plantings ensure easy enjoyment. Further highlights include ducted heating, split cooling, luxurious contemporary bathrooms with abundant storage, timber floors, alarm, garden shed, and the remote double garage with rear access. Perfectly peaceful and private in this premium Kew position, effortless living is further enhanced by a convenient walk to Kew Junction retail and dining, vibrant local eateries and renowned restaurants, Kew Primary, High Street trams and CBD bound buses with prestigious private schools, Kew High and the Eastern Freeway all available within minutes.
